Tips for Viral Marketing
An effective viral marketing campaign can generate enormous interest and create positive brand association but there is no magic formula.

While each viral campaign is unique, here are a few basic tips to follow:
Pick the right content
You can't have a boring image or broad topic engage people and be sent down the viral hole.
Types of Content that have an opportunity to go viral:
1. Controversial
2. Very Helpful and Unique
3. Amazing/Spectacular
4. Humor
As a business the most beneficially and possibly easiest category for a viral marketing campaign would be #2.
Know your audience
The first step when implementing a viral campaign is to identify what motivates your audience. It’s worth doing research and analyzing your target market.
Be prepared
Caution should be used in your viral marketing campaigns when the possibility for exponential viral traffic is available. There have been countless web sites brought to their knees when a surge of traffic and server requests are generated from their viral marketing campaigns.
You must ensure you have the hardware and server capacities to handle the traffic should a viral event occur.

Jump start your virus
Many businesses will have a valuable asset which most of the other community contributors will not have: Employees.
To help jump start a viral movement with your business’s content or contributions, you will have the option of using your employee base as the beginning of your online network, social supporters, followers, friends, and other elements contributing your viral campaign.
In the end a viral campaign is all about the product. If you're trying to force a campaign to go viral it's very hard to achieve, it has to come natural.
